On a solar ship - you generate 4MW of solar power from panels at 20% efficiency - using the surface area of the largest container ship.

4000kW. $400/kw. 1.6M for the panel.

Cargo ship uses 16 tons of fuel per hour. Fuel cost is $300/ton. $38M/year in fuel.

About 8000 hours per year. 16x300x8000=$38M

1 container ship creates as much pollution as 50M cars.

A typical ship has a 9 MW power use.
